Bird Of Happiness

 

oViAa3x.jpg

 

Level 3

Winged-Beast

 

When this card is Normal Summoned: You can target 1 Level 5 or higher Tuner monster in your Graveyard; Special Summon that target in Defense Position. And if you do, apply one of these effects: (1) Reduce the Level of the Special Summoned monster by 3. (2) This monster's Level becomes same as the Special Summoned monster's, but you cannot Synchro Summon for the rest of the turn.

 

Blue Bird of Paradise Lost

 

ZkehUNj.jpg

 

Level 8

Wyrm / Tuner

 

This card gains 100 ATK and DEF for each Tuner monster in your Graveyard. Once per turn: You can banish 1 Tuner monster from your Graveyard, then target 1 monster your opponent controls; destroy all other monsters on the field whose current ATK is less than or equal to the original ATK of the target.

Seal of Paradise Lost

 

9YjJmJC.jpg

 

If you control no face-up monsters: Pay 1000 LP; Special Summon 1 "Paradise Lost" monster from your Deck in face-up Attack Position or face-down Defense Position. If you control no monsters: You can shuffle this card and 1 Level 6 or higher Tuner monster from your Graveyard into your Deck; draw 1 card. You can only activate 1 "Seal of Paradise Lost" per turn.

 

Presents from Paradise Lost

 

VO30b2G.jpg

 

If your opponent controls a monster and you control no monsters: You can send 1 Level 6 or higher Tuner monster from your hand and 1 from your Deck to the Graveyard; draw 2 cards. If you control no other cards, draw 3 cards instead.
